China's crude steel production up 8.4pc.

China produced 748 million mt of crude steel in January to September, 8.36 percent higher from the same period last year, said China Iron and Steel Association (CISA) executive vice-chairman He Wenbo at a press conference on October 29. Domestic production of crude steel this year will likely increase 7.1percent from that in 2018, to stand at 994 million mt. He said "the growth rate is considered rather high given a high base in 2018." He added that the additions in steel output were consumed domestically as both inventories and exports shrank...
